Understanding the Warning Signs:

Being aware of possible cancer symptoms helps people seek medical advice when needed. Symptoms may vary depending on the type of cancer, but some common warning signs include:

  • Unexplained weight loss
  • Persistent fatigue
  • Unusual lumps or swelling
  • Changes in skin appearance
  • Continuous pain without a clear reason
  • Unusual bleeding
  • Changes in normal body functions

These signs do not always mean cancer, but discussing them with a healthcare provider can help identify the cause and provide proper guidance.

The Importance of Regular Screenings:

Screening is a valuable tool that helps detect certain cancers before symptoms appear. These tests allow healthcare professionals to identify changes in the body and recommend suitable treatment options at an early stage.

For breast cancer, screenings such as mammograms, clinical examinations, and self-awareness practices are important parts of maintaining breast health. Understanding personal risk factors and following recommended screening schedules can help individuals stay proactive.

A few minutes spent on regular health checks can contribute to protecting a lifetime of wellness.

Advances in Cancer Treatment:

Medical progress continues to improve cancer care through advanced technologies and personalized treatment methods. Doctors now have access to better diagnostic tools and treatment approaches that are designed according to each patient’s specific needs.

Modern cancer treatments may include:

  • Surgery
  • Radiation therapy
  • Chemotherapy
  • Targeted therapy
  • Immunotherapy
  • Hormone therapy

These developments provide new hope and allow many patients to achieve better outcomes while maintaining their quality of life.
